Why this matters in Willis
The tragic drowning of a 15-year-old boy in a flooded retention pond in Montgomery County is a stark reminder of the dangers that come with heavy rainfall in the area. As Willis residents know, the city's proximity to Lake Conroe and its location in a low-lying area near Interstate 45 make it prone to flooding. The Montgomery County Sheriff's Office has likely dealt with its share of flooding-related incidents, and this latest incident will undoubtedly have the community on high alert. With more rain expected in the region, residents should be cautious when approaching flooded areas, including retention ponds, which can be deceptively deep and swift. The incident also raises questions about the safety measures in place around these ponds, particularly in areas where children may be present. As the community mourns the loss of the young boy, it's crucial to focus on prevention and safety to avoid such tragedies in the future.
